If 'Surviving R. Kelly' came on TV, 'we were to immediately change the channel,' said the witness, who's testifying as a 'Jane Doe' in federal court in Brooklyn.

“He was letting us know he was in the room with us,” she said of the cough.

The trial is unfolding under coronavirus precautions restricting the press and the public to overflow courtrooms with video feeds. That’s made it difficult to gauge the reactions of Kelly, who has been jailed since his federal indictment was announced in 2019. That interview was also the first time he directly addressed the allegations made in the Lifetime documentary.

They said he used his stardom to lure them into an insular world where he watched their every move and doled out perverse punishments, spanking them and isolating them in hotel rooms if they broke a vow to never speak about him to anyone else.
